IJK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

617 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F (IJK)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$4.78B — up 5.2% from $4.54B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 124 funds opened new IJK positions and 28 closed out — a net gain of 96 holders — while 155 added to existing stakes and 199 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Envestnet Asset Management, adding an estimated $38.8M. The largest seller was Stifel Financial, cutting an estimated $56.7M.
